    Trade deadline has ended before it even begins

    From a professional standpoint, business standpoint, common sense standpoint... all of these... Ken Holland's wisdom make sense. I'll use this as my source of injuries: http://www.cbssports.com/nhl/injuries Take a look at those names for the Red Wings. The majority of them have missed a lot of games. They are all solid players and/or veterans NHLers. At the moment, the Wings are not at the place in the standings that we have been accustomed to the past 15 or so years. However, given the circumstances (injuries, heavily relying on younger players, several long-time veterans departing, just simply not having the same core group of guys we had 10 years ago, etc.), they are in a very good place in the standings. We have been used to being in the top 10, but now a series of unfortunate events has brought us where we are. For a team that has so many injured veterans, I'm happy with how well they're doing. Now just imagine that, for all intents and purposes, those injured players are free agents. Now, around the trade deadline the headlines read "Wings make big moves at trade deadline, acquire Bertuzzi, Helm, Colaiacovo, Samuelsson and Filppula." My thought is: "Wow!" Players coming back from lengthy injuries really IS just like making big trades or signings, rather anyone wants to believe it or not. That's veteran players coming back into the game, where our team has been tested without them. If anyone translates Holland's logic to "Our injured players returning to play will shoot us up to first place in the standings." Well, I'm sorry to tell you this, but you're expectations are too high by any standard, and you need to get your head out of the clouds. Our returning veterans will definitely improve the team's overall performance. It could be a matter of being in a "safer" 7th or 8th position (league-wide standings) rather than a nail-biting 15th or 16th position, where the Wings may not make the playoffs at all. Maybe even 7th or 8th is shooting too high. The fact of the matter is that adding those veterans to the lineup will be a huge benefit. EDIT: It is my belief that being a little more conservative with trades and signings today allows a team to build camaraderie and chemistry, which makes for a much better team tomorrow than acquiring star players to fill in gaps. It's like a snowball effect. Let the snowball grow, don't make it lopsided by packing snow in areas to make it bigger... you'll just knock it off course!

  5. http://www.nhl.com/ice/news.htm?id=656993&navid=DL|NHL|home Personally, I think the number of situations where challenging a call would help in the NHL is very small. It's one thing in football, but in a fast-paced game like hockey, I don't think it would help much. I'd anticipate some coaches taking advantage of their new ability. I can't think of any specific coaches that would do that, but I mean after a while it seems like once it's been taken advantage of one time it will snowball to teams taking advantage of it whenever they can. Of course, there will be rules and penalties against abusing the system. But I don't see this being an improvement to the game of hockey.

  16. I found my way to this page from hockeydb.com: http://www.hockeydb.com/ihdb/stats/leagues/141.html From 1942 to 1967 (25 years) the NHL had 6 teams, then expanded to 12 teams in 1967. This is the longest streak the NHL went so far without an expansion. Then from 1979 to 1991 (12 years) the NHL had 21 teams, then expanded to 22 teams in 1991. As of the end of this season, the NHL will have gone 12 years again without expanding. These 3 eras are the longest streaks the NHL has gone without expansion.
